Ladies & Gentlemen: The following message received from Rich Moseson, W2VU, the editor of CQ Magazine today: Hi Tom, I just want to give you a heads-up that there will be a couple of articles critical of ARRL actions in the upcoming December issue of CQ. First, my editorial (which has a different primary focus) takes issue with the way in which the board went about dealing with the election in the Southeastern Division. (We do not take a position on whether the action was justified or not, but rather on the process and the perceptions.) Secondly, our DX column takes issue with the rate increase for the Outgoing QSL Bureau, particularly the impact on the "little-guy" DXer of the per-transaction "processing fee" on top of the higher per-ounce rates. For those who will almost certainly accuse us of "League-bashing," I want to emphasize that we are taking issue with certain actions of the organization, not the organization itself. Both our DX Editor and I are long-time ARRL members who have served in various volunteer roles over many years.
